Araloselachus cuspidatus Agassiz 1843

Chondrichthyes - Lamniformes - Odontaspididae

Alternative combinations: Araloselachus cuspidata, Carcharias (Odontaspis) cuspidata, Carcharias cuspidata, Carcharias cuspidatus, Lamna cuspidata, Odontaspis (Synodontaspis) cuspidata, Odontaspis cuspidata, Sylvestrilamia cuspidata, Synodontaspis cuspidata

Synonym: Lamna denticulata Agassiz 1843

Full reference: L. Agassiz. 1843. Recherches Sur Les Poissons Fossiles. Tome III (15me, 16me livraison) 157-390

Belongs to Araloselachus according to J. A. VillafaƱa et al. 2020

Distribution:

• Quaternary of Taiwan (1 collection), United States (1: Georgia)

• Pliocene of Argentina (3), United States (1: North Carolina)

• MN 13 of Portugal (1)

• Hemphillian of United States (1: Florida)

• Miocene of Australia (6), Austria (4), the Czech Republic (1), France (5), Germany (4), Hungary (2), Italy (2), Japan (1), the Netherlands (1), Poland (2), Portugal (4), Slovakia (4), Spain (6), United States (9: Delaware, Maryland, New Jersey, North Carolina, Virginia)

• Oligocene to Miocene of Australia (1)

• Oligocene of France (1), Germany (3), Hungary (1), the Netherlands (2), Romania (2), United States (1: South Carolina)

• Eocene of Australia (3), Germany (1), Japan (1), Romania (1), the United Kingdom (2), United States (5: Georgia, Maryland, Texas, Virginia)

• Paleocene of Togo (1), United States (5: Illinois, Maryland, New Jersey)

• Cretaceous to Paleogene of United States (1: New Jersey)

• Cretaceous of United States (5: Delaware, Maryland)

Total: 95 collections including 98 occurrences
